在数字艺术和动画制作的领域,大模型(Large Language Models,LLMs)正逐渐成为一股不可忽视的力量。这些模型通过学习海量数据,能够生成高质量的文本、图像和视频内容,从而为动画制作带来革命性的变化。本文将深入探讨大模型在动画奇观打造中的应用,解析其背后的技术和优势。
大模型概述
大模型是一种基于深度学习的人工智能模型,通常由数亿甚至数千亿个参数组成。这些模型通过分析大量数据,能够学习到复杂的模式和结构,从而实现高度自动化的内容生成。在动画制作中,大模型可以应用于多个环节,包括角色设计、场景构建、动画效果生成等。
大模型在动画制作中的应用
1. 角色设计
大模型可以基于已有的角色设计数据,生成新的角色形象。通过分析大量角色图像和描述,模型可以学习到不同风格和特征的组合,从而创造出具有独特个性的角色。
# 示例代码:使用大模型生成新角色形象
import openai
# 初始化API
openai.api_key = 'your-api-key'
# 生成角色形象
response = openai.Completion.create(
engine="text-davinci-002",
prompt="设计一个具有未来科技感的机器人角色,身高1.8米,皮肤呈银灰色,拥有机械臂和激光眼。",
max_tokens=128
)
# 输出角色形象
print(response.choices[0].text.strip())
2. 场景构建
大模型可以生成具有真实感的场景图像。通过分析大量场景图像和描述,模型可以学习到不同环境、建筑和自然景观的细节,从而生成逼真的场景。
# 示例代码:使用大模型生成场景图像
import openai
# 初始化API
openai.api_key = 'your-api-key'
# 生成场景图像
response = openai.Completion.create(
engine="text-davinci-002",
prompt="生成一幅描绘未来都市的夜景,高楼大厦林立,霓虹灯闪烁,天空中有飞行器穿梭。",
max_tokens=128
)
# 输出场景图像
print(response.choices[0].text.strip())
3. 动画效果生成
大模型可以生成高质量的动画效果,如流体、烟雾、爆炸等。通过分析大量动画效果图像和描述,模型可以学习到不同效果的细节和动态,从而生成逼真的动画效果。
# 示例代码:使用大模型生成动画效果
import openai
# 初始化API
openai.api_key = 'your-api-key'
# 生成动画效果
response = openai.Completion.create(
engine="text-davinci-002",
prompt="生成一段爆炸效果的动画,火焰四溅,烟雾弥漫,画面呈现动态感。",
max_tokens=128
)
# 输出动画效果
print(response.choices[0].text.strip())
大模型的优势
1. 提高效率
大模型可以自动化动画制作过程中的多个环节,从而提高制作效率,降低成本。
2. 创新性
大模型可以生成具有独特风格和创意的动画内容,为动画制作带来更多可能性。
3. 可扩展性
大模型可以轻松扩展到不同的动画制作领域,如电影、游戏、广告等。
总结
大模型在动画制作中的应用前景广阔,能够为动画奇观的打造带来革命性的变化。随着技术的不断发展,大模型将在动画制作领域发挥越来越重要的作用。